Abstract

Provided is an organic light emitting display device. The organic light emitting display device includes: a plurality of sub-pixels including an anode and a cathode; an anode line configured to supply an anode voltage to the anode; and a cathode line configured to supply a cathode voltage to the cathode, and in each of the plurality of sub-pixels, a direction of an anode voltage input of the anode line and a direction of a cathode voltage input of the cathode line are different from each other and face each other in order to reduce a deviation in a potential difference between the anode and the cathode. Thus, it is possible to improve uniformity in the potential difference between the anode and the cathode caused by a line resistance.
